Utahs two U.S. senators are questioning a new Pentagon policy that leaves Christian off the designation for The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ints.
The Department of War recently announced the reduction in the number of religious affiliation categories for service members from over 200 down to 31. Categories that were removed from the list include atheist and humanist, and Wicca.
The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ints is included as a religious category on the updated list. But the faith was not included in the list of faiths labeled Christian.
Sen. Mike Lee, R-Utah, put up a screenshot of the list on X and asked Can anyone tell me why The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ints was left out of the list of Christian churches?

This week, however, a related problem emerged, though in an unexpected way: Instead of seeing Hegseths Defense Department take steps to elevate one faith tradition, Americans are seeing the Pentagon demote other faith traditions. The Religion News Service reported:
The Department of Defense is substantially reducing the number of religions it officially recognizes, reportedly excluding atheists, pagans, humanists and New Age faiths, an independent military-focused news website reports.
The reduction of recognized faith groups represents the first time the military has revised the list since 2017, when it vastly expanded the list of recognized faith groups to about 211. The new list includes 31 recognized faiths, as first reported by Military.com on Thursday (June 4).
The Military.com report was based on a memorandum issued by Anthony Tata on May 20. (Tata, the under secretary of defense for personnel and readiness, is perhaps best known for his record of anti-Muslim rhetoric and bonkers condemnations of Barack Obama, whom Tata described as a terrorist leader. Last year, Senate Republicans confirmed him anyway.).....
